You want to park your vehicle. You must NOT park within 20 metres

either side of




an intersection with traffic lights.




a safety zone.




a traffic island. - ANSWER✔✔-an intersection with traffic lights. ✔


You park at the side of the road. You leave three metres of the road clear.

Which road lines are you allowed to park opposite?




Copyright ©EMILLECT 2024. ALL RIGHTS RESERVED. Page 1/43

,A continuous yellow edge line at the side of the road




Continuous double white lines in the centre of the road




A broken white line in the centre of the road - ANSWER✔✔-A broken

white line in the centre of the road ✔


You are driving vehicle A out of the driveway. When should you sound

your horn?




Always




When you don't have a clear view of the footpath




Copyright ©EMILLECT 2024. ALL RIGHTS RESERVED. Page 2/43

,Never - ANSWER✔✔-When you don't have a clear view of the footpath ✔


You are driving in heavy traffic. Your lane is blocked by a vehicle turning

right.




Wait until the vehicle turns, then proceed.




Sound your horn until the vehicle turns.




Try to squeeze past on the footpath on the left of the vehicle. -

ANSWER✔✔-Wait until the vehicle turns, then proceed. ✔


You are stopped at a railway crossing without gates, booms or flashing

lights. A train has just passed. What should you do?




Move off quickly so that vehicles behind you are not delayed.
Copyright ©EMILLECT 2024. ALL RIGHTS RESERVED. Page 3/43

, Look carefully both ways to check for other trains before moving off.




Wait until vehicles are crossing in the other direction before moving off. -

ANSWER✔✔-Look carefully both ways to check for other trains before

moving off. ✔


You are approaching a railway crossing. A railway employee is signalling

you to stop. You cannot see any trains coming. What should you do?




Stop.




Slow down and drive carefully across.




Sound your horn and drive across as quickly as possible. - ANSWER✔✔-

Stop. ✔
